Ben Wilkinson, Osteopath

Ben graduated from European School of Osteopathy with a Masters in Osteopathy in 2015 as a GOsCregistered osteopath and member of the British Osteopathic Association. 

Ben played rugby to semi-professional level before sustaining a serious shoulder injury that required several surgeries and eventually forced him to retire This experience gave him great insight into sports injuries and the affect they can have on many other aspects of life.  

He later worked as a professional yachtsman before returning to the UK to undertake study in osteopathy. 

Ben still has his passion for sport, now competing in rowing with his brother.  Although he can no longer play rugby, he has stayed in the game as an official osteopath to Gloucester Rugby Club
